"The scales LIE" (You can't fool mother nature) If we "cheat" then weigh in the next morning, and don't gain, it gives us a false sense of relief like we "got away with it" but the scales don't know if what you ate was 1/2 pound of watermelon or a 1/2 pound of butter. You can't know how badly a "cheat" hurts you until probably 2-3 days later when your body is finished processing it. As they say, you can't fool mother nature. Everything counts - everything adds up. The reaction to what the scales tell you if you weigh too much can be "I got away with it - I'll eat more" or it could be "Oh, no! the scales went up when I was really careful, so why try?" and also eat more. Moral to the story - never trust the scale - trust that whatever you have eaten will count - or whatever you have resisted will earn you progress, regardless of what the scale might say. To find the true story as to why your weight went up or down go back three days and see what you ate that day.
